
Piña Colada Day on July 10th celebrates the iconic tropical cocktail that originated in Puerto Rico in 1954, created by bartender Ramón "Monchito" Marrero at the Caribe Hilton Hotel. This refreshing drink, made with rum, pineapple juice, and cream of coconut, has become a beloved summer favorite worldwide. Honour the icon today by mastering this reSIPe:
Fill a large jar with 1 cup of crushed ice, add 60 ml Havana Club Añejo 3 Años rum, 100 ml fresh pineapple juice, 30 ml coconut milk, and 5 ml lime juice (optional), stir, close the lid, shake for 30 seconds, and serve in a hurricane glass filled with ice.
